# Django REST framework 3.8

The 3.8 release is a maintenance focused release resolving a large number of previously outstanding issues and laying
the foundations for future changes.

## Breaking Changes

### Altered the behaviour of `read_only` plus `default` on Field.

[#5886][gh5886] `read_only` fields will now **always** be excluded from writable fields.

Previously `read_only` fields when combined with a `default` value would use the `default` for create and update
operations. This was counter-intuitive in some circumstances and led to difficulties supporting dotted `source`
attributes on nullable relations.

In order to maintain the old behaviour you may need to pass the value of `read_only` fields when calling `save()` in
the view:

def perform_create(self, serializer):
serializer.save(owner=self.request.user)

Alternatively you may override `save()` or `create()` or `update()` on the serialiser as appropriate.

---

## Deprecations

### `action` decorator replaces `list_route` and `detail_route`

[#5705][gh5705] `list_route` and `detail_route` have been merge into a single `action` decorator. This improves viewset action introspection, and will allow extra actions to be displayed in the Browsable API in future versions.

Both `list_route` and `detail_route` are now pending deprecation. They will be deprecated in 3.9 and removed entirely
in 3.10.

The new `action` decorator takes a boolean `detail` argument.

* Replace `detail_route` uses with `@action(detail=True)`.
* Replace `list_route` uses with `@action(detail=False)`.


### `exclude_from_schema`

Both `APIView.exclude_from_schema` and the `exclude_from_schema` argument to the `@api_view` decorator are now deprecated. They will be removed entirely in 3.9.

For `APIView` you should instead set a `schema = None` attribute on the view class.

For function based views the `@schema` decorator can be used to exclude the view from the schema, by using `@schema(None)`.

## What's next

We're currently working towards moving to using [OpenAPI][openapi] as our default schema output. We'll also be revisiting our API documentation generation and client libraries.

We're doing some consolidation in order to make this happen. It's planned that 3.9 will drop the `coreapi` and `coreschema` libraries, and instead use `apistar` for the API documentation generation, schema generation, and API client libraries.

* Correct allow_null behaviour when required=False [#5888][gh5888]

Without an explicit `default`, `allow_null` implies a default of `null` for outgoing serialisation. Previously such
fields were being skipped when read-only or otherwise not required.

**Possible backwards compatibility break** if you were relying on such fields being excluded from the outgoing
representation. In order to restore the old behaviour you can override `data` to exclude the field when `None`.

For example:

@property
def data(self):
"""
Drop `maybe_none` field if None.
"""
data = super().data()
if 'maybe_none' in data and data['maybe_none'] is None:
del data['maybe_none']
return data
